High Purity Sodium Cyanide
Wiki Article
Industrial grade sodium cyanide is a highly toxic chemical compound widely utilized in various industrial processes. It exists as white, odorless crystals and melts quickly in water. This versatile chemical finds applications in diverse industries, encompassing metal plating, mining, and the production of textile materials.
- As a result of its toxicity, industrial grade sodium cyanide demands stringent handling and safety protocols. }
- Operators should wear appropriate personal protective equipment and conduct activities in well-ventilated areas to avoid exposure risks.

Identifying Reliable Sources for Hazardous Materials
When dealing with hazardous materials, obtaining reliable sources is paramount. A trusted reference can equip you with reliable details about the properties of hazardous substances. Consult government agencies, industry organizations, and specialized publications for thorough resources.
- Institutes like OSHA and the EPA provide valuable regulations for the safe processing of hazardous materials.
- Safety data sheets (SDSs) present detailed facts about specific chemicals and potential hazards.
- Scientific journals often publish latest studies on hazardous materials.
